EasyUI is an HTML5 framework for using user interface components based on jQuery, React, Angular, and Vue technologies. It helps in building features for interactive web and mobile applications saving a lot of time for developers.
In this article, we will learn how to design a Radiobutton using jQuery EasyUI. The Radiobutton widget is used to make a radio button that can be used to select the needed option. Only one option can be selected in a group.

Syntax:
<input class="easyui-radiobutton">
Properties:
- width: It is the width of Radiobutton component to be made.
- height: It is the height of Radiobutton component to be made.
- value: It is the default value bound to the Radiobutton to be made.
- checked: It defines if the Radiobutton is checked to be made.
- disabled: It defines if to disable the Radiobutton to be made.
- label: It is the label bound to the Radiobutton to be made.
- labelWidth: It is the label width.
- labelPosition: It is the label position. The possible values are ‘before’, ‘after’ and ‘top’.
- labelAlign: It is the label alignment. The possible values are ‘left’ and ‘right’.
Event:
- onChange: It fires when the value is changed.
Methods:
- options: It returns the options object.
- setValue: It sets the value for the Radiobutton.
- disable: It disables the component.
- enable: It enables the component.
- check: It checks the component.
- uncheck: It unchecks the component.
- clear: It clears the ‘checked’ value.
- reset: It resets the ‘checked’ value.
